Weekly Contemplative Bible Study: Each week at the 5:30pm Wednesday service, participants engage the ancient practice of lectio divina--a way of reading scripture with the heart as well as the mind. We take the Gospel for the upcoming Sunday as our text for lectio divina. Join us for this weekly opportunity to encounter Scripture.

Faith Exploration Class: Every year, St. Thomas offers a spring and fall course for adults who desire to deepen their connection with God, with the parish, and with our Anglican practices, history, and identity. This course offers an opportunity to delve into questions of faith and scripture as well as inquiry into the particular mechanics of worship, church leadership, community, and service. If you are new to St. Thomas, this class is an ideal way to get plugged in. Long-time and less new parishioners also find it a chance to re-examine questions and re-engage with their life of faith.
